  • Nearly 18 months after the lake was renamed Knight Lake—formerly known as Swastika Lake—in January 2024 to honor geologist Samuel Knight, residents remain divided. Some locals say the change removes a chance to teach the broader history of the swastika while others support distancing the lake from its Nazi association.  Cowboy State Daily

  • At Cheyenne Frontier Days, quadriplegic photographer Shane Paul captured a slow-motion video that turns a five-second bull ride into 21 seconds—showing the ride's raw power and the rider's struggle to stay on while Paul plans to return for the finals this weekend. His work reaffirms his passion for capturing Wyoming's rugged outdoor spirit after overcoming a serious accident on Laramie Peak.  Cowboy State Daily

  • The Wyoming Business Alliance, Wyoming Community College Commission, and the University of Wyoming have partnered to expand student internships & work-based learning opportunities. The agreement will help students gain practical experience & prepare for future careers.  Laramie Boomerang

  • The city of Laramie has approved closing Ivinson from 6th-to-9th for the Ivinson Sewer Project. The closure will run from August 1 to September 21 to complete the necessary work.  City of Laramie
